USA Today’s Nate Davis shared his 2025 NFL season predictions in August. Unfortunately, it is a disappointing forecast for Chicago’s football team. For what it’s worth, Davis predicts the Bears will win more games than they did last year. But he also envisions another season with double-digit losses:Chicago Bears (7-10): They’re going to have to adapt – to Johnson, their new head coach, who’s changing the culture, scheme and expectations (yet again) after this organization’s disastrous 2024 campaign. And the learning curve is amplified by a schedule that, statistically, is second only to the Giants’ in terms of difficulty. Six of the Bears’ final eight opponents made the playoffs last season.

Lions quarterback Jared Goff had sack rates of 3.77% (2022), 4.72% (2023), and 7.71% (2024) during Ben Johnson’s time as the offensive coordinator in Detroit. Perhaps the first-year Bears head coach will have an idea of how to protect Caleb Williams from the onslaught of pass-rushers the NFC North has to offer. A Minnesota Vikings injury up ESPN’s Kevin Seifert reports the team is optimistic that wide receiver Jalen Nailor will play in the Week 1 opener against the Bears on Monday Night Football. Nailor suffered an injury to his left hand on Aug. 14 during training camp and was deemed to be “week-to-week” by Vikings Head Coach Kevin O’Connell. The team lost free-agent addition Rondale Moore with a season-ending injury and will be without Jordan Addison for the first three games because of a suspension. But Minnesota brought in wideout Adam Thielen via trade last week to help out the receivers’ room, so the cupboard isn’t completely bare. Pittsburgh Steelers running back Jaylen Warren signed a two-year contract extension with the team. Warren figures to get more touches in 2025 after watching Najee Harris leave for the Los Angeles Chargers in free agency.
